The new guidelines for long and wide transports were announced by the Swedish Transport Agency in 2023, but will only come into effect at the end of July 2025.
The Transport Agency’s regulations and general advice specify a number of important details for operating wide or long transports in Sweden.
For example, it explains which signs must be used (long load / wide load), how to mark the width of wide transports, and which warning lights and lamps are required on large transports.
The most discussed point in the industry right now is the new size requirements for signs on escort vehicles. These must now be at least 1.2 meters wide and 0.4 meters high.
